Man Posthumously Awarded Medal For Heroism

A Columbus man who drowned trying to save a boy from a frozen pond has been awarded the Carnegie Medal for heroism. The Carnegie Hero Fund Commission has honored 30-year-old James Jenkins for risking his life to dive into a pond at an East side apartment complex to rescue 5-year-old Elijah Walker last year. Neither Jenkins nor Walker survived.
